Growing length scale accompanying vitrification: A perspective based on nonsingular density fluctuations
1Institute of Industrial Science, University of Tokyo, Meguro-ku, Tokyo 153-8505, Japan.
Physical Review. E
|March 18, 2018
Summary
A new model explains growing length scales during vitrification by identifying "glassy clusters" where particle movement is restricted. This model predicts how these clusters influence material properties with changes in density or temperature.
Area of Science:
- Condensed Matter Physics
- Materials Science
- Statistical Mechanics
Background:
- Vitrification, the process of forming a glass, involves a growing length scale.
- Existing models often rely on complex thermodynamic arguments to explain this phenomenon.
Purpose of the Study:
- To introduce a new model for vitrification that describes the growing length scale.
- To explain the mechanism behind this length scale divergence without complex thermodynamics.
Main Methods:

- Predicted the divergence of the characteristic cluster length scale (ξ) with compression (increasing density ρ) and cooling (decreasing temperature T).
Main Results:
- The model predicts a diverging length scale ξ∼(ρc−ρ)−2/d with increasing density and ξ∼(T−Tc)−2/d with decreasing temperature, where d is spatial dimensionality.
- The predicted exponent for the diverging length scale matches existing theoretical models and experimental observations.
- The proposed mechanism for length scale divergence is distinct from thermodynamic anomalies associated with phase transitions.
Conclusions:
- The model provides a simpler, non-thermodynamic explanation for the growing length scale during vitrification.
- The concept of glassy clusters and steric constraints offers a new perspective on the cooperative nature of structural relaxation in supercooled liquids.

The Behavioral Perspective on Personality
847
Behaviorists view personality as primarily shaped by environmental reinforcements and consequences. According to this perspective, behavior is influenced by external stimuli, and individuals adjust their actions based on rewards and punishments. Over time, learning histories — accumulated patterns of reinforcement — play a significant role in shaping personality. Behaviors that lead to positive outcomes are reinforced, while those resulting in negative outcomes are diminished.
